A kitten's eyes and ears have opened several weeks ago, but at 6 weeks of age, the eyes will still be blue. Hearing and vision are fully developed, and over the next couple of weeks, the eye color will slowly change to be the final adult eye color. Until about 6 weeks of age, a kitten will need supplemental heat to stay warm.
